SolMicroGrid Announces Appointment of Kirk Edelman as Chief Executive Officer

N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--SolMicroGrid, an Energy-as-a-Service microgrid company focused on commercial and industrial (“C&I”) end markets, announced today the appointment of Kirk Edelman as Chief Executive Officer, effective immediately. Kirk joins SolMicroGrid following recent senior executive roles at Safari Energy, a solar-focused renewables developer focused on C&I end markets, and Verdagy, a green hydrogen company. SolMicroGrid continues to be backed by Morgan Stanley Energy Partners, part of Morgan Stanley Investment Management.

John Moon, Head of Morgan Stanley Energy Partners, said, “We are delighted to be partnering with Kirk Edelman as the next CEO of SolMicroGrid. He brings years of senior executive experience in scaling C&I-focused renewable energy businesses. We look forward to working with Kirk in his new role to support the continued growth of SolMicroGrid. Kirk embodies the world-class talent we seek to partner with in all our energy businesses.”

Kirk Edelman, CEO of SolMicroGrid, said, “I am excited to join the SolMicroGrid team and to continue delivering on our customers’ ambitious energy resiliency, sustainability, and cost-efficiency goals. I believe in the company’s mission and look forward to expanding the business to serve new customers and new end markets.”

SolMicroGrid continues to operate, construct, and develop solar-enabled microgrid assets for its C&I clients and is committed to finding innovative solutions to customers’ energy and resiliency needs.

About SolMicroGrid

Headquartered in Alpharetta, Georgia, SolMicroGrid is a differentiated developer and operator of solar-enabled microgrid systems offering energy resiliency and efficiency to commercial and industrial customers. SolMicroGrid is a portfolio company of Morgan Stanley Energy Partners. For further information about SolMicroGrid, please visit www.solmicrogrid.com.

About Morgan Stanley Energy Partners

Morgan Stanley Energy Partners, the energy-focused private equity business of Morgan Stanley Investment Management, is a leading energy private equity platform that makes privately negotiated equity and equity-related investments in energy companies located primarily in North America. Morgan Stanley Energy Partners pursues a differentiated investment strategy, focused on the buyout and build-up of strategically attractive, established energy businesses across the energy value chain in partnership with world-class management teams.
